PE platform acquires New York ophthalmology practice — 4 insights

Ophthalmology investment platform SightMD partnered with New York City-based Park Avenue Eye Institute.

Advertisement

 

What you should know:

1. Robert R. Ditkoff, MD, founded and owns the practice.

2. Park Avenue Eye Institute is SightMD’s second office in Manhattan.

3. Dr. Ditkoff will continue to see patients out of the office.

4. This is SightMD’s eighth partnership since it became a portfolio company of Chicago Pacific Founders.
